Detailed Crime Rate Comparison
| Crime Type | Needham | Plymouth Township |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Crime Rate | 698.6 | 700.9 | -2.2 |
| Violent Crime Rate | 51.9 | 48.5 | +3.4 |
| Murder Rate | 0.0 | 0.0 | +0.0 |
| Rape Rate | 12.2 | 3.7 | +8.5 |
| Robbery Rate | 0.0 | 3.7 | -3.7 |
| Aggravated Assault Rate | 39.7 | 41.0 | -1.4 |
| Property Crime Rate | 646.8 | 652.4 | -5.6 |
| Burglary Rate | 73.2 | 33.6 | +39.7 |
| Larceny-Theft Rate | 536.9 | 533.1 | +3.8 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ft Rate | 36.6 | 85.7 | -49.1 |
All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Plymouth Township, MI
Plymouth Township, Michigan, a suburban community west of Detroit, is known for its historic downtown Plymouth and the popular Art in the Park festival. It features a diverse mix of residential areas and light industrial parks, with a population exceeding 27,000. With a safety score of 85/100 and a population coverage of 26,824, Plymouth Township has a total crime rate of 700.9 per 100,000 residents.
